#DDBAB1 Color

#DDBAB1 is rgb(221, 186, 177) in RGB, hsl(12, 39%, 78%) in HSL, and about cmyk(0%, 16%, 20%, 13%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Millennial Pink (#F3CFC6), clearly related but distinguishable side by side at ΔE 7.62. Black text is the more readable choice on this background.

What #DDBAB1 Is Called

Most hex codes have no name: there are 16.7 million of them and a few thousand registered names. These are the named colors nearest to #DDBAB1, ordered by CIE76 distance in CIELAB. Anything under about ΔE 2 is a difference most people cannot see.

Text Contrast & Accessibility

W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#DDBAB1 background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

Fails AAWhite text1.79:1AA normal AA large AAA normal
TextBlack text11.73:1AA normal AA large AAA normal

#DDBAB1 Frequently Asked Questions

What color is #DDBAB1?

#DDBAB1 is a light red — rgb(221, 186, 177) in RGB and hsl(12, 39%, 78%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Millennial Pink (#F3CFC6), which is clearly related but distinguishable side by side at a CIE76 distance of 7.62.

What is the RGB value of #DDBAB1?

#DDBAB1 is rgb(221, 186, 177) — red 221, green 186, and blue 177 on the 0-255 scale.

What is the CMYK value of #DDBAB1?

#DDBAB1 converts to approximately cmyk(0%, 16%, 20%, 13%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.

Should text on #DDBAB1 be black or white?

Black text is the more readable choice. #DDBAB1 scores 1.79:1 against white and 11.73: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.

Can I write #DDBAB1 as a CSS color keyword?

No. #DDBAB1 is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is pink (#FFC0CB) at a CIE76 distance of 14.78, which is visibly different.
